The Sum of Perfection
By: Saint John of the Cross
Forgetfulness of created things,
remembrance of the Creator,
attention turned toward inward things,
and loving the Beloved.

2015 Reading List Update
The first book of the year that I finished is:
The Hidden Power of Kindness by Father Lovasik
This is actually the published version by Sophia Institute Press.
The book was so inspiring to me that I went on a search and found the original that is still published through Father Lovasik's family! I am re-reading this book in it's original format because it is that good and important in helping me overcome vices that tend to be looked over/dismissed as petty.
